WebDivorce tracts of John Milton. Soon after these controversies, Milton became embroiled in another conflict, one in his domestic life. Having married Mary Powell in 1642, Milton was a few months afterward deserted by his wife, who returned to her family’s residence in Oxfordshire. WebParadise Lost is an epic poem by John Milton that was first published in 1667.It relies on the underlying structure of ancient epics to portray the Christian worldview as noble and heroic, arguing that God’s actions, for people who might question them, are justified—hinting that humankind’s fall serves God’s greater purposes.

WebComus. In his first appearance in the masque, Comus encourages his debauched followers to engage in a mirthful party of food, drink, and carnality. He celebrates the "slumber" of virtues like advice, age, rigor, and severity, associating nightfall with the freedom to indulge.
